Abstract
We construct a continuous semigroup of weak, dissipative solutions to a nonlinear partial differential equation modeling nematic liquid crystals. A new distance functional, determined by a problem of optimal transportation, yields sharp estimates on the continuity of solutions with respect to the initial data.
